Chapter 365: 365 - A Tough Decision


"I said open up!" the voice became louder, the the hitting even more so. Inside, all four people held their breath, as they waited to see what would follow, ready to fight if needed.


"Sir, like I said, this room is under maintenance and locked from the inside. Only when the maintenance crew arrives tomorrow will we have access to it again," a female's voice could be heard from beyond the door, trying to convince the man.


"Tsch! I guess there's no helping it."


Noah and those inside eyes each other, waiting for the cue, sitting back down as the noise of people slowly seemed to die down.


"... Khish, why would it be you?" Sha furrowed her brows as soon as they relaxed, looking around to see Noah and Al avert their gaze.


"Long story short, they wanted to get rid of me, but for some inexplicable reason I didn't die in the suicide mission they sent me to," she said, making Sha curl her fists.


"To think they would go as far as to aim for you just to keep themselves spotless and s.h.i.+ny... This family ir completely rotten to the core," Sha muttered, her usual bright self nowhere to be seen. Noah's eyes wandered towards her, as he felt if he let her be there might be a ma.s.sacre... Somehow.


"Sha... You shouldn't worry so much about those things anymore," he said, making the healer snap out, looking at him with widened eyes. "I'm going to take care of them, so you don't have to worry too much about it. Khish can help me and Carlos with information and counterinteligence, Allie already is the owner of the Ice parlor we worked, though it will take a little to renovate the whole place. Meanwhile, we can have them two train fortress diving with the kids and get her acknowledged as a Blessed. You don't have to worry too much," he said, making Sha look down while smiling wryly.


"You know, sometimes it feels like I'm completely useless," she said, thinking of how she failed to protect both of her sisters. Yet, contrary to her expectations, Noah was the first to refute her.


"That's never going to be true," he said, making the girl look up to see both her sisters nodding.


"Even if you didn't manage to stop our parents back then, you went out of your way to leave home and go searching for me, didn't you?" Allie called her out with a warm smile.


"But I didn't find you..."


"Because they were sabotaging you from doing so. It was never your fault. I, as your older sister, should've been the one to warn you what they were planning on doing to us, so that you could've protected Khish. Compared to me, you're a way better sister," Allie said, a smile on her face still. By this time, Noah was already feeling completely left out and alien to the whole thing. After all, he was not part of their family.


"Both of you, you did your best. It was my fault that I didn't listen to anyone and chose to believe until I had no other choice but to face the truth..." she put her hands together onto the table, letting both of the others hold hers. "But in the end, all three of us owe everything to a single person."


"Yeah, that is true. Even meeting today," Sha said, turning towards Noah, and catching his attention back from dozing off.


"Eh? Why are you looking at me like that? Me?" he asked, met by the three's eyesight.


"Of course! Now, let's drink and eat~!" Al cheered, and coincidently, a small hatch opposite to the door opened up, bringing more foods and drinks to them.


"Eh? Since when was there something like that over there?" Khish asked, surprised at how seamless the wall looked before, and how, aside from Noah, everyone had surprise no idea about the fact there wa.s.s still more food to arrive.


"What? They told me there was more stuff coming," he said, before turning standing up and putting the recently arrived food onto the table.


The four spent over an hour eating and drinking, before someone knocked onto the door to the room they were in. "Noah, is everything good?" Noah heard the voice of his friend, standing up and unlocking the door.


"Yeah. Is it all done and dealt with?" he asked, the young waiter nodding.


"They have gone away, and we have confirmed there to be n.o.body watching the exits of this establishment. You may leave whenever you feel is best," he said, talking a fleeing glance at the girls over Noah's shoulders. "But to think you would be this popular... I'll have to tease Carlos for not being able to do the same next time around."


Noah and him laughed it off, and Noah headed back inside. "By the way, thanks for warning me," he said, looking back over his own shoulder.


"Don't sweat over it. It is part of my job to protect our high-profile customers too," he said with a broad smile, before closing the door back up and leaving.


"So... There's this one thing we haven't talked about," Noah called the girls out, who were already at least half drunk. "Where are you guys heading from here?" he asked, realizing three things.


One, it was too late to do what he had arranged with Maggie; Two, Sha was probably going alone; and Three... Khish probably had nowhere to go.


"Eh...? Me is going with you back home like we had said," Al answered like normal, but Noah didn't fail to realize the slip-up in her sentence.


"You know it's not about you, Al." Noah rolled his eyes, his eyes meeting with Khish's.


"I mean... I don't know. It was so good being here with all of you that I forgot..." she muttered, embarra.s.sed, as she thought where she was going to spend the night.


"We can have her come to my place. I have a spare bedroom," Sha said while tilting her head, but Noah quickly shot her down.


"That's too dangerous. You family already has an eye out for you, if you take Khish home, there's no telling what they could do to her and you. I can't let that happen," Noah explained, making Sha pout a little.


"Then why don't you take her to live with you just like you are already doing to Allie anyways?" she protested, her face looking rather cute to him.


"You got it all—"


"I think that might be a good idea." As he was mid-sentence into refuting her claim about Allie living together with him, Khish herself interrupted.


"That's even more dangerous!" Noah stood up, realizing they were about to agree with her. "Both you and Allie are targets. They want both of you dead. You two living together in the same place just makes it more convenient for them," he said, looking at Sha's surprised face. "Living with Sha is a no because I don't want her to get caught up if you ever get attacked, but living with Allie is just taunting them," he said, as his mind spun trying to find a better solution to this whole ordeal.


'OH...' he came to a realization, thinking about it better. "I think I know how to fix all of this," he said, making the three look at each other curiously, as Noah pulled his phone.


"Carlos?" he asked, as he stopped hearing the tone of his call.


[Yeah?! Where the h.e.l.l are you? Maggie is p.i.s.ssed that you lied about the sleep-over,] Carlos immediately complained, making Noah smile.


"Some things happened. The place we were eating was targeted and we had to wait for them to leave."


[d.a.m.nit! So, what is it, then? I'm guessing it's all dealt with by now.]


"Well... sorta," Noah said half laughing, as he threw a glance around. "Remember the the girl who broke into my house and all?" he asked, trying to fill Carlos in.


[Of course I do, what about it? Did she try something stupid again?] Noah almost burst into laughter at Carlos' caustic remarks, but kept it cool.


"No, but let me get this going. Remember the pink haired healer that is part of my group?"


[Yeah, yeah, your Blessed Girlfriend,]


"She's not my—nevermind," Noah stopped mid-sentence, realizing Sha's eyes on him, and reminding himself of the strange quest he had gotten from the flames. "Her. And also, the girl from the ice-cream place earlier today," he kept speaking making Carlos feel slightly uncomfortable.


[Yeah, yeah. I remember all of them! Why are you talking as if this is somehow related to—]


"They are all sisters," Noah interrupted him, making Carlos freeze up for an instant.


[Excuse me...?] he asked in shock, both staying silent for a few minutes, before he spoke once again. [f.u.c.k... I see what the problem is. I'll send someone to pick the car and a driver with a larger one. We can check the details for what is going to happen afterwards here, but you shold always leave some imps with them, got it?!] Noah swallowed dry at Carlos' perception, and for a second envied his ease in understanding others' problems.


"Welp, I guess it's all sorted. Sha, Khish, you're gonna join Allie tonight in a sleepover with my sister," he said, surprising the three.


"So we're not going just to our home together?!" Al asked, making Noah widen his eyes, and realize there was at least one big misunderstanding earlier... Provided this was not just the alcohol speaking.
